If you have no wind minor changes in elevation and set your cruise control to no more than 5mph over on the freeway you should expect right at 30mpg.
However, once you stab it getting on the freeway, goosing it in 5th gear for the urge, or varying your speed too much it will start to go done. My problem is I can't stop listening to my motor's sweet music long enough to break that barrier except every once and a while.
You have to squeeze the accelerator and drive like you have an egg under the pedal to get over the 30mpg mark.

use the upper button on the right to scroll through the computer display until you get to the avg MPG and Avg MPH and then hold the upper button for 1-2 seconds until the screen clears and flashes "----". then keep driving and a few miles later it will give you new readouts

Another 300 mile trip yesterday yeilded me 27.7mpg and that was with at least 20% in town driving. I do creep off the line with the other traffic and don't let her rev up too much however before I shift into another gear. Only a couple of times did I go over 3500 rpm. Most of the time I was shifting under 3K.
Don't get me wrong you have to blow your car out every once in a while. But, if you take it easy you should be able to get really good mileage.
